Recipe for puff pastry snack
Small, easy snacks made from a roll of store-bought puff pastry and a jar of pesto from the supermarket – how easy can it get!
Serve the tasty puff pastry pieces as snacks, as part of an appetizer, or as an accompaniment to soup.

Puff Pastry Snack
Ingredients
- 1 pcs. Puff Pastry
- Pesto red
- Pesto green
Instructions
- The puff pastry roll is unrolled and cut in half.
- Each half is spread with either green or red pesto.
- The piece of dough with green pesto is cut into strips about 1 centimeter wide and "twisted" by rotating one end. You should end up with long "sticks" of dough that resemble Italian grissini.
- The piece of dough with red pesto is rolled up like a roulade and cut into slices about 1/2-1 centimeter thick.
- Both types of puff pastry snacks are baked in a conventional oven at 200 degrees Celsius (392 degrees Fahrenheit) for about 15 minutes.
- Cool on a wire rack before serving.
Notes
Replace green and red pesto with olive and tomato tapenade. It's also delicious!
